在模组方面,营运管理部门处于领先地位。营运管理模组包括持续监控电动车充电网路并提供即时警报和通知的工具。此外,它还提供自动问题诊断和远端解决功能,有助于提高网路可用性和稳定性。它还配备了先进的功能,例如洞察驱动的仪表板,用于不断收集、视觉化和分析营运数据以优化营运。这将使充电基础设施高效可靠地运作。

从充电器部署方面来看,私营部门预计将引领潮流。背后的原因是持续缺乏足够的公共充电基础设施,这对电动车的广泛普及构成了重大挑战。事实上,许多电动车用户选择在家充电而不是在公共充电站充电,这种趋势正在影响市场。因此,儘管公共充电基础设施正在建设中,但只要家庭和私人财产的充电环境得到改善,人们相信电动车将有可能进一步普及。

根据充电器类型,2 级充电器预计将引领市场。原因在于电动车驾驶想要一个实用的行驶里程。许多企业和电动车车主倾向于选择 2 级充电,其充电速度比 1 级更快。

从地区来看,中国占据市场领先地位。根据中国电动车充电基础设施最新数据显示,中国拥有全球最大的电动车充电管理软体平台。中国的电动车基础设施正在快速扩张,全国已安装超过 220 万个充电站,推动了该市场的成长。

EV charging management software enables e-mobility service providers and EV charging operators to manage all aspects of EV charging, maximizing charger uptime and providing EV drivers with a seamless charging experience. Furthermore, the software enables EV charging providers to monetize their services. Some of the major benefits of EV charging management software include energy usage and cost optimization, complete control of charging infrastructure, remote management of EV infrastructure, seamless charging experience for drivers, possibility of cost reduction and revenue generation, automation of EV billing and payments, and the ability to achieve interoperability.

Operation management will dominate EV charging management software platform market (by modules). The operations management module of EV charging management software includes tools for continuously monitoring EV charging networks and providing real-time alerts and notifications. It also includes tools for automatically diagnosing and remotely resolving problems, thereby increasing network availability and stability. Insight-driven dashboards for constantly collecting, visualizing, and analyzing operational data to optimize operations are among the advanced features.

Level 2 will dominate EV charging management software platform market (by charger type). Due to EV drivers' desire for a reasonable range, most organizations and EV owners prefer Level 2 charging to Level 1 charging. Level 2 charging adds about 25 miles per hour (RPH), whereas Level 1 charging adds about 4 miles per hour (RPH) Because charging an EV takes nearly a full day, Level 1 is too slow for the amount of time most drivers spend at a typical business and thus will not appeal to them. Level 2 charging also allows a company to serve a greater number of drivers on a daily basis, resulting in more customers.

Recent Developments in the EV Charging Management Software Platform Market

  • In February 2022, EV Connect Expands EV Charging-as-a-Service Program supported by investor Mitsui & Co., Ltd. (Mitsui) was launched. The program combines hardware, software, and service offerings with flexible payments to EV Connect customers to create a one-stop shop for worry-free EV charging.
  • In June 2022, NovaCHARGE announced successful pilots of a new Hot Standby feature that provides mobile network redundancy and eliminates single-point failover at the mobile carrier level were completed. This feature enables more robust EVSE communications to address the critical need for timely EV charging in fleet, workplace, public, and high-density residential customers.
  • In September 2021, e-Mobility Power (eMP), the major provider of electric vehicle charging in Japan, migrated and consolidated its complete network of over 27,000 chargers to the Driivz end-to-end EV charging and smart energy management software platform.
  • In February 2021, EVBox launched a real-time EV charging infrastructure Insights business portal. The new business portal Everon, a brand of EVBox, allows fleet and site managers control over the functioning of their EV charging infrastructure.
